Description
I run a query like this:
```
../../sources/codeql/codeql query run ./queries/types-flow.ql -d ../../sources/linux-6.12.74/linux-db/ -j0 --ram 10240 > ./results/types-flow.txt
```
I get
```
types-flow.ql: [1/1 eval 4m37s] Failed: Query evaluation ran out of Java heap (Java heap maximum: 2070 MiB).
(eventual cause: OutOfMemoryError "Java heap space")
CodeQL is out of memory. Try increasing the memory available to CodeQL using the --ram option.
make: *** [Makefile:44: types-flow] Error 99
```
Clearly I passed 10GB to `--ram`, why does the error message say that the java heap maximum is 2GB?
